%X NodD, the major regulatory protein of nodulation, was partially purified from Rhizobium leguminosarum 8401(pIJ1518), and its binding sequences within nodF promoter of R.l. bv. viciae were determined by DNase I footprinting. A series of techniques based on gel retardation were used to analyze the NodD_target DNA interaction, showing that NodD binds to target DNA in isologous octamer.
